Old Mill is a urban community in York,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a small locality. Old Mill is located at 43.6508°N, 79.4922°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: M6S.
Old Mill occupies a sheltered hollow where the landscape leans toward the water, shaped by the persistent movement of the Humber River. It lies 13.9 km south-west of Toronto, ON (from Toronto, ON: bearing 223°T), and is situated 15.1 km east-north-east of Mississauga. The weight of the air here carries a damp coolness, a lingering breath that rises from the Humber River as it nears its journey’s end at Lake Ontario. Shadows lengthen across the valley floor at dusk, turning the stone foundations of the original structures into silhouettes that seem to hold the weight of a century. Long ago, the currents of the river powered the early industry that gave Old Mill its name, turning the wheels that ground grain for a growing province. Today, the water moves with a quiet authority past the heavy timber and masonry of the historic inn, where the local economy shifts between the quiet persistence of hospitality and the modern life of the surrounding district. While the sprawling Parc urbain national du Canada de la Rouge lies 38 km away, the immediate horizon of Old Mill remains defined by the dense, protective curve of the riverbanks and the sudden, open expanse where the stream meets the lake. The pace of daily life follows the water, observant and steady, marked by the soft clatter of nearby transit and the occasional rustle of leaves caught in the river breeze.
